Nuclear power plant workers face unique occupational health risks that require specialized monitoring and documentation. This Nuclear Power Plant Worker Health Monitoring Form provides a comprehensive solution for tracking radiation exposure, conducting thyroid screenings, evaluating psychological fitness, and assessing overall fitness-for-duty for personnel working in nuclear facilities.
Comprehensive radiation exposure tracking is built into this template, allowing health and safety teams to document cumulative dosimetry readings, track exposure incidents, and maintain accurate records required by regulatory agencies. The form captures both routine monitoring data and any unusual exposure events that require investigation.
The thyroid screening section addresses one of the most critical health concerns for nuclear workers, as the thyroid gland is particularly sensitive to radioactive iodine exposure. This template helps occupational health professionals systematically document thyroid function tests, physical examinations, and any concerning symptoms that may indicate radiation-related thyroid issues.
Psychological evaluation components recognize that working in high-stress, safety-critical environments requires ongoing mental health monitoring. The form includes assessment areas for stress management, attention to detail, decision-making capacity, and overall psychological wellness—factors essential for maintaining a safe nuclear facility.
